- 1、本文档共71页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
深度学习教程主讲人:
目录01深度学习理论基础02深度学习实践技巧03深度学习案例分析04深度学习工具应用05深度学习未来趋势
深度学习理论基础01
神经网络简介神经网络的基本结构神经网络由输入层、隐藏层和输出层组成,每层包含多个神经元,通过权重连接。激活函数的作用激活函数为神经网络引入非线性因素,使网络能够学习和执行复杂的任务。
学习算法原理梯度下降是优化算法的核心,通过迭代调整参数以最小化损失函数,实现模型的训练。梯度下降法正则化技术如L1、L2用于防止过拟合,通过在损失函数中添加惩罚项来约束模型复杂度。正则化技术反向传播算法用于多层神经网络,通过计算损失函数关于权重的梯度,实现权重的更新。反向传播算法010203
损失函数与优化损失函数衡量模型预测值与真实值之间的差异,指导模型优化。损失函数的作用正则化防止模型过拟合,通过添加惩罚项到损失函数中来控制模型复杂度。正则化技术梯度下降是优化算法的核心,通过迭代更新参数以最小化损失函数。梯度下降法
正则化与泛化能力通过L1、L2正则化减少模型复杂度,防止训练数据上的过拟合现象。避免过拟合引入Dropout等技术,增强模型对未见数据的预测能力,提升泛化性能。提高泛化性能使用交叉验证评估模型泛化能力,减少模型选择偏差,提高模型的稳健性。交叉验证方法通过网格搜索、随机搜索等方法选择合适的正则化参数,平衡偏差和方差。正则化参数选择
深度学习实践技巧02
数据预处理方法归一化是将数据按比例缩放,使之落入一个小的特定区间,如0到1,以提高模型训练效率。归一化处理01处理缺失数据,常用方法包括删除含有缺失值的样本、填充缺失值或使用模型预测缺失值。缺失值处理02
模型选择与调参根据问题类型选择CNN、RNN或Transformer等模型架构,以适应不同的数据和任务需求。选择合适的模型架构01设定学习率、批大小、迭代次数等超参数的初始值,为模型训练打下基础。超参数的初步设定02利用交叉验证方法细致调整超参数,以找到模型性能的最优配置。交叉验证优化超参数03采用正则化、dropout等技术防止模型在训练数据上过拟合,提高泛化能力。避免过拟合的策略04
训练技巧与加速使用Adam或RMSprop优化器可以加速模型收敛,提高训练效率。选择合适的优化器01采用学习率衰减或周期性调整学习率,有助于模型在训练过程中稳定学习。调整学习率策略02使用预训练的模型作为起点,可以加速训练过程并提高模型性能。利用预训练模型03通过GPU或TPU集群进行并行计算,可以显著缩短训练时间,提高效率。并行计算与分布式训练04
模型评估与验证选择合适的评估指标根据问题类型选择准确率、召回率或F1分数等指标,以准确衡量模型性能。交叉验证方法超参数调优使用网格搜索、随机搜索等方法优化模型超参数,提升模型的预测准确度。采用K折交叉验证等技术减少过拟合,提高模型在未知数据上的泛化能力。混淆矩阵分析通过构建混淆矩阵,深入理解模型在各类别上的预测表现和错误类型。
深度学习案例分析03
经典问题案例图像识别中的过拟合问题在图像识别任务中,深度学习模型可能会过度学习训练数据的噪声,导致泛化能力下降。自然语言处理中的语义理解难题深度学习在自然语言处理中常遇到挑战,如理解句子的深层语义和上下文关系。强化学习中的探索与利用困境在强化学习中,智能体需要在探索新策略和利用已知策略之间找到平衡,以最大化长期奖励。
应用领域案例利用深度学习技术,AI在医疗影像分析中识别病变,提高诊断的准确性和效率。医疗影像分析深度学习在自然语言处理中应用广泛,如智能客服和语音识别系统,极大改善用户体验。自然语言处理自动驾驶汽车使用深度学习进行环境感知和决策,如特斯拉的Autopilot系统。自动驾驶技术金融机构运用深度学习模型评估信贷风险,提高风险预测的准确性和效率。金融风险评估
案例中的问题解决数据预处理在深度学习项目中,数据预处理是关键步骤,如对图像数据进行归一化,以提高模型训练效率。模型调优通过调整超参数,如学习率和批大小,优化模型性能,解决过拟合或欠拟合问题。异常值处理在案例分析中,识别并处理数据中的异常值,可以避免模型训练时的误导,提高准确性。
深度学习工具应用04
常用深度学习框架谷歌开发的TensorFlow是目前最流行的深度学习框架之一,广泛应用于研究和生产环境。TensorFlow01由Facebook的人工智能研究团队开发,PyTorch因其动态计算图和易用性而受到研究人员的青睐。PyTorch02
工具安装与配置根据项目需求选择TensorFlow、PyTorch等框架,并确保其与操作系统兼容。选择合适的深度学习框架安装Python、CUDA、cuDNN等软件,并设置环境变量,以便深度学习模型的训练和测试。配置开发环境使用pip或conda安装N
文档评论(0)